Title: Galveston Bay Area, Texas. Navigation Study
Author: U.S. Army Engineer District, Corps of Engineers, Galveston, Texas Galveston.
Abstract: Galveston Bay, the largest inland bay on the Texas coast, provides access to the principal ports of Houston, Texas City, and Galveston. The purpose of this comprehensive navigation study is to investigate the existing Federal projects serving these ports to determine the advisability of modifying these channels. Any proposed channel modification would be compatible with plans of other Federal, state, and local agencies, and would be designed to protect the surrounding environment and to preserve or enhance the economic and social well-being of the affected population.
